Getting The Life You Want: Mothers Group Spring Retreat
The retreat is open to all members of the Mothers Groups and St. Columba’s Church. Take stock of your life as it is now and how you would like it to be. Recent author of Lose Weight, Find Love, De-Clutter & Save Money: Essays on Happier Living, master certified and executive life coach Michele Woodward will address understanding and living your values; priority setting; overcoming objections, barriers and challenges; using your time to support your values and priorities; envisioning the life you want; and making a plan, determining objectives and next steps. Cost is $40 and includes lunch and free time activities. We’ll go out for dinner afterward. Questions? Contact Katie McGervey (301-587-2283). |
